Timothy O. Rencken, Esq.

Image of Nashville-based attorney Timothy O. Rencken

Tim is an entertainment attorney based in Nashville, TN. After first moving to Nashville in 2013 to attend Belmont University, Tim began working as a hired side musician. Years later, his passion for music and intellectual property law guided many of his choices in law school, where he participated in the University of Richmond’s Intellectual Property and Transactional Law Clinic. In his final year of law school, Tim commuted between Nashville, TN and Richmond, VA while touring extensively with a Nashville country artist.

 

Tim has experience with various areas of music, entertainment, and intellectual property law relating to copyrights, trademarks,  and other IP matters, as well as contract and general business matters, including entity formation. He has a passion for helping artists and musicians make informed decisions and obtain the compensation they deserve. While working as an attorney, Tim still tours and remains active in the Nashville music scene.
